Have you ever seen a license plate so unique that it made you look at it again? A Nevada license plate recently caused a frenzy on Facebook and went viral. With the bold message “Go back to California”, the recording has received over 80,000 likes. There is a catch though – the Nevada DMV has since revoked the plate!
The Nevada DMV follows strict rules for personalized plates and ensures that they remain appropriate. For example, tags like “SAUC3D” and “RAMP4GE” were rejected for suggesting offensive content, while others like “F4K3 T4XI” and “BUYAGRAM” were rejected for suggesting illegal activities. Not every application will pass the keen eyes of the control committee.
